ERIE, PENNSYLVANIA — At a rally on Wednesday, Senator JD Vance (R-OH) voiced strong concerns over Vice President Kamala Harris’s policies and their potential impact on the trucking industry. Addressing a crowd of truckers and supporters, Vance criticized the administration’s push towards electric vehicles, arguing it could severely disrupt the trucking sector.

Vance highlighted the critical role truckers play in the American economy, pointing out that goods from groceries to retail products are transported thanks to their efforts. He expressed frustration with what he perceives as a lack of understanding from Harris and the Biden administration regarding the realities of the trucking business.

"Without American trucking, nothing works," Vance stated. "How do you think groceries get to stores? How do products get to retailers? They get there with American truckers. We do not have an economy unless American truckers can do what they do so well."

The Senator took issue with Harris’s policies that aim to raise fuel costs and push for a transition to electric trucks. He criticized the administration's proposal as impractical, noting the current high cost of electric trucks compared to diesel models. "An electric truck costs around $400,000 right now, while the administration claims it will eventually match the price of diesel trucks," Vance said. "Forcing truckers to switch to these expensive electric vehicles will exacerbate inflation and worsen economic conditions."

Vance also warned of broader economic implications, suggesting that Harris’s policies could drive up costs across various sectors. "You think groceries are expensive now? Wait until Kamala Harris makes every trucker drive an electric truck. You think car prices are high? Imagine if everyone had to buy a Chinese-made electric vehicle," he said.

The Senator's remarks extended beyond the trucking industry to a critique of the overall economic impact of Harris’s policies. He highlighted that average workers in Pennsylvania are financially worse off compared to when Donald Trump was in office, citing increased costs and stagnant wages.

"Under Kamala Harris’s policies, the average worker’s wages have declined, and the cost of living has increased," Vance argued. "Donald Trump has a better idea. He wants to ensure more take-home pay for workers, empower truckers, and bring back economic stability."

Vance concluded his speech with a call to action, urging voters to support Trump as a remedy to what he views as the detrimental policies of the current administration. "We need to get Donald Trump back in the White House," he declared, "because the current policies are failing our workers and making life harder for everyone."

The rally underscored Vance’s alignment with Trump's economic policies and his opposition to Harris's approach to environmental and economic issues.
